What Are Nose Fillers?

Nose fillers, also known as liquid rhinoplasty, non-surgical nosejob or nose augmentation, are a no-downtime and non-surgical aesthetic treatment designed to enhance the shape and contour of the nose. By injecting dermal fillers into specific areas on the nose, this treatment smooths out irregularities, lifts the nasal tip and refines the nose bridge. It provides a treatment alternative to surgical rhinoplasty or nose threadlifts, with immediate results and minimal downtime.

Who Should Get Nose Fillers?

Nose fillers are suitable for individuals who:

Have Nose Bumps – If you have a bump on the nose bridge that you’d like to smooth out, fillers can help create a more even contour.

Have a Drooping Nasal Tip – Fillers can lift and define the tip of the nose for a more youthful, balanced appearance.

Have a Flat Nose Bridge – If you desire more height and definition in your nose bridge, fillers can provide a subtle lift.

Notice Minor Asymmetries – Fillers can correct small imperfections for a more harmonious and symmetrical profile.

Who Should Avoid Nose Fillers?

Nose fillers may not be suitable for those who:

  • Are Pregnant or Breastfeeding – It's advised to wait until after pregnancy and breastfeeding before undergoing treatment.
  • Have an Active Skin Infection – Any skin condition or infection near the injection site should be cleared before considering fillers.
  • Have Bleeding Disorders – Those with conditions that affect blood clotting may be at higher risk for bruising or complications.

Aesthetics for Men and Women

While the core technique of nose fillers involves injecting hyaluronic acid-based filler to reshape the nose, the aesthetic goals often differ between genders — and understanding facial proportions is key to achieving natural, flattering results!

For men, the ideal nose typically features a higher, more prominent nasal bridge and a straighter profile. A stronger, more angular nose enhances masculine features and balances other defining elements, like a broader jawline or a more prominent brow.

For women, the aesthetic focus usually leans toward a slimmer, more delicate bridge with a gentle curve and a slightly lifted tip. This creates a softer, more feminine silhouette that harmonises with other facial features like the cheekbones and lips.

Catering for Ethnic Features

Nose filler can also be a way of enhancing your unique ethnic features while maintaining your identity. Many Asian and Southeast Asian individuals, for example, naturally have a flatter nasal bridge or a shorter nose length. With careful placement of dermal filler along the radix and dorsum, you can add height and definition to the nose - giving it a more contoured look without erasing the features that define your heritage.

Nose Filler Treatments Offered at Bay Aesthetics Clinic

At Bay Aesthetics, we offer the following fillers for nose enhancement:

  • Hyaluronic Acid (HA) Fillers: A high G-prime filler such as Juvederm Volux is commonly used for nose contouring. It lasts up to 12-18 months.
  • Calcium Hydroxylapatite (Radiesse): For those seeking long-lasting results, Radiesse is a collagen-stimulating filler that can enhance the structure and definition of the nose.

Polycaprolactone (Ellanse): This filler provides long-lasting volume with a natural aesthetic result, with effects lasting up to 24 months.

How Much Filler Is Needed?

The amount of filler required for nose enhancement depends on your individual facial structure and aesthetic goals. Generally, 1-2cc of filler is enough to achieve satisfactory cosmetic outcomes.

How Long Do Nose Fillers Last?

The results of nose fillers can last from 12 to 18 months, depending on the type of filler used and your metabolism.

Risks of Nose Fillers

While nose fillers are generally safe when done by experienced doctors, some potential risks include:

  • Vascular occlusion: This occurs when filler is injected into a blood vessel, leading to blockage and tissue necrosis (leaving an open wound and scar on the skin). It is a rare complication but requires immediate medical attention.
  • Blindness: accidental intravascular filler injection may lead to filler emboli blocking the blood vessels supplying the eye, leading to blindness. It is a rare complication but requires immediate medical attention.
  • Infection: The Injected filler may become contaminated and infected, requiring further treatment with antibiotics or surgical drainage.
  • Asymmetry or unsatisfactory results: Adjustments or additional treatments may be needed to achieve the desired result.
  • Nodules or lumps: These can occur if the filler is unevenly distributed.

Overfilling and avatar nose: Excessive nose filler injected poorly can lead to unnatural results, such as an “Avatar nose”

Note: These risks apply to all filler treatments. Due to the delicate structures of the nose, it’s essential to choose an experienced practitioner to minimise these risks and ensure an ideal outcome.

What to Expect During Your Nose Filler Treatment

  1. Consultation: Our doctor will assess your facial anatomy and discuss your aesthetic goals.
  2. Preparation: The area around your nose will be cleaned and a topical numbing cream will be applied to minimise discomfort during the injections.
  3. Injection: Using a fine needle, the doctor will inject the filler into the targeted areas to sculpt and define the nose.
  4. Post-Treatment: You may experience some mild redness, swelling or bruising, which typically resolves within a few days. We'll provide you with the necessary aftercare instructions.
  5. Follow-Up: We’ll schedule a follow-up appointment to ensure you’re happy with the results and to make any necessary adjustments.

FAQs

Will nose fillers change the shape of my nostrils?

No, nose fillers are designed to enhance the overall structure and contour of the nose without altering the shape of your nostrils.

Can I combine nose fillers with other treatments?

Yes, nose fillers can be combined with other treatments, like chin or jawline fillers, for overall facial enhancement.

Are nose fillers permanent?

No, nose fillers are not permanent. The results typically last 12-18 months, depending on the type of filler used.

Is the treatment painful?

Most patients experience minimal discomfort with the application of a numbing cream. The procedure is quick and well-tolerated.

I have a nose implant. Can I do nose fillers?

It is not recommended to perform nose fillers in the presence of a permanent surgical nose implant due to the risk of infection
